M6400 power adapter

I have a Dell M6400 laptop.  Up till yesterday, it functioned perfectly.  Yesterday morning, I noticed that I was running on plug in power adapter. But today, when I got home, It was turned off, I check the power and it was plugged in. I unplugged the power adapter for 30 seconds and replugged back in, the green light was on and I checked the laptop and it showed charging, but hear some buzzer noise that came out from the power adapter. After plugging in about 5 minutes, the green light on the power adapter was off and it showed no charging. If I unplug and replug it will be working for another five minutes again. I don't know what's going on, if anyone know how to fix this problem, please help. Look like the capacitor inside the power adapter is not working well.
